Exhibition: "A Napoleonic Panorama: The French Campaigns in Italy

The exhibition "Un Panoramique napoleonien: Les Campagnes des Français en Italie" will run from 22 November 2023 to 26 February 2024 at the Château de Bois-Préau in Rueil-Malmaison, France. Destination Napoleon: towards a shared national strategy for Napoleonic routes

On Tuesday 10 October, the "Destination Napoleon in Italy - Towards a shared strategy" meeting was held at the Villa Bottini, in the presence of the Deputy Director of Tourism, Remo Santini. Auxonne, a new member in France

On 4 October 2023, the town of Auxonne in France joined the European Federation of Napoleonic Cities.
